I. Understanding Ultrasonic Welding
Ultrasonic welding is a solid-state joining process that uses high-frequency ultrasonic vibrations to create a strong bond between metal and plastic components. The process involves the use of an ultrasonic welding machine, which generates mechanical vibrations at a frequency of 20 kHz to 70 kHz. These vibrations cause the surfaces of the metal and plastic parts to rub together, generating heat and forming a molecular bond.
II. Methods of Ultrasonic Welding Metal to Plastic
There are two primary methods for ultrasonic welding metal to plastic: direct and insert welding.
Direct welding involves directly welding the metal and plastic components together. The metal part is placed on the horn of the ultrasonic welding machine, while the plastic part is held in position with a clamping system. The ultrasonic vibrations are then applied to the interface of the metal and plastic parts, causing them to fuse together.
Insert welding, on the other hand, involves embedding a metal insert into the plastic component before ultrasonic welding. The metal insert is designed with features such as knurls, undercuts, or a threaded design to create a strong mechanical interlock with the plastic material. During the ultrasonic welding process, the vibrations help to soften and melt the plastic around the insert, creating a secure bond.
III. Benefits of Ultrasonic Welding Metal to Plastic
Ultrasonic welding metal to plastic offers several significant benefits for manufacturers:
Improved Strength and Durability: Ultrasonic welding creates a strong and durable bond between metal and plastic components, ensuring the integrity of the final product.
Enhanced Aesthetics: The welding process leaves no visible marks or residue, resulting in a clean and professional appearance for the joined parts.
Increased Production Efficiency: Ultrasonic welding is a fast and efficient process, allowing for high-speed production with minimal energy consumption.
Cost Savings: The elimination of adhesives, fasteners, and additional materials reduces production costs and simplifies the assembly process.
